What is gender cleavage?

Gender cleavage refers to the social and political divisions between different genders, often manifested in varying interests, perspectives, and behaviors. This concept highlights how these divisions can influence political alignment, voting behavior, and social dynamics, particularly in contexts where gender issues are prominent. It underscores the importance of understanding how gender identity and roles can shape individual and group experiences within society.


What does gender cleavage mean?

Gender cleavage refers to the social, economic, and political divisions or distinctions that exist between men and women in society. It can manifest in various forms such as differences in access to opportunities, resources, and power based on one's gender. Addressing gender cleavages is important for promoting equality and inclusion for all individuals.
